This woodblock print by Nishimura Shigenaga depicts the kabuki actor Arashi Wakano. Shigenaga was a significant figure in the early development of Ukiyo-e, operating a studio in Edo that produced numerous prints of actors and famous beauties. His work often utilised the benizuri-e technique, a form of early colour printing that relied on a limited palette of pink and green pigments applied to the monochrome base.
The composition features the actor standing beneath a large, open umbrella, framed by flowering plum branches. The figure wears a kimono decorated with a series of smaller, framed portraits, a stylistic choice that adds a layer of visual complexity to the garment. The actor's pose is graceful, with a slight tilt of the head that suggests a moment of performance or a staged portrait. The lines are precise and calligraphic, characteristic of the early eighteenth-century style, which prioritised clarity of form over the atmospheric depth seen in later periods.
Shigenaga was known for his influence on younger artists, including Suzuki Harunobu, who would later refine the multi-block printing process. This print captures the aesthetic of the period, where the focus remained on the stylised representation of the human form and the decorative potential of textiles. The muted colour palette, aged by time, provides a soft quality to the paper, allowing the black ink outlines to define the subject clearly. The inclusion of the artist's signature and seal confirms the authenticity of the work, placing it within the broader context of Edo-period print culture. This piece offers a view into the theatrical world of the eighteenth century, where actors were celebrated as icons of popular culture, their likenesses captured in these accessible, mass-produced images.
